One thing that customers need to remember is that with “Bill Pay”, the merchants and billing organizations that can be paid through the system are limited. Again, in the drop down menu under “Bill Payee”, a list has been created by the bank but over time, this feature will be expanded as the product grows and launches in other regions of the world occur.
To complete a payment to a merchant, you would go to the “Payee” tab under “Bill Payee”. Choose the merchant already entered by Standard Chartered Bank or enter one acceptable by the system, enter your Bill Account Number, which is the number used by that particular merchant so you can link to the bill, and then determine the amount to pay. Once submitted, the payment is sent.
Another benefit to using the Breeze mobile banking application is that another person’s credit card can also be paid with this system as long as it is a Visa or MasterCard and for an individual within Singapore. Keep in mind that since Breeze is currently available in both Singapore and Malaysia, there are limitations for this but this application will soon be rolled out to India and Hong Kong, followed by global markets.
The process that Standard Chartered Bank’s Breeze mobile banking solution provides for payments going to a credit card with another bank is so easy that the payment can be completed within a matter of minutes. The Visa or MasterCard information would be entered into the system under the list of registered payees under the “Payee” tab and once entered, whenever a payment needs to be made that card would simply be chosen from the drop down menu. After the payment has been initiated, it will take approximately two days for it to be processed.
